Technical Description

The ROLL-IN HS1418 Horizontal Band Saw is engineered for precision cutting with a robust 2.0 HP motor, operating at 230/460V three-phase power. It features a versatile cutting capacity, accommodating rectangular, round, and square materials up to 14.0 inches in height at 90 degrees. For angled cuts, it offers a rectangular capacity of 7 inches by 18 inches and a round capacity of 12 inches at 45 degrees. At 90 degrees, the rectangular cutting capacity expands to 13 inches by 18 inches, while the round capacity reaches 14 inches. The saw utilizes a 1.0-inch wide blade with a thickness of 0.035 inches and a length of 165.0 inches, providing durability and efficiency. Blade speeds are adjustable across three settings: 70, 140, and 240 FPM, allowing for tailored cutting performance. The spacious table measures 24 inches by 30 inches or an alternative size of 31.5 inches by 25.5 inches, positioned at a comfortable height of 31 inches from the floor. The saw also features a swivel capability of 60 degrees in both directions, enhancing its versatility. With a shipping weight of 1,500 lbs and overall dimensions of 48.5 inches in width, 80 inches in height, and 90 inches in length, the ROLL-IN HS1418 is a robust and efficient solution for demanding cutting applications in various industrial settings.
